Ultraviolet disinfection is non selective in the destruction of all water borne bacteria, pathogens, viruses, veligers and micro-organisms.  A partial list of organisms responsible for fish diseases that are treatable using state-of-the-art ETS  disinfection systems are:

. Whirling disease Viral                             . Nervous Necrosis (VNN)

. Ulcerative Dermal Necrosis (UDN)         . Ichtyophthirius (white spot disease)

. Infectious Salmon Anaemia (ISA)          . Flavo Bacterium

. Saprolegnia (fungal disease)                 . Viral haemorrhagic septicaemia (VHS)

. Proliferative Kidney Disease (PKD)        . Vibrio Anguillarum

Aquaculture applications include:  

FISH FARMS | Market pressures has lead to a demand for more wholesome, chemical and antibiotic free products; In order to stay competitive more intensive farming and greater yields are needed. ETS' disinfection systems are used worldwide to prevent infection and disease.

HATCHERIES | Egg production and fry growth are critical applications for Ultraviolet disinfection. Successful production, improved yields and reduced mortality are all benefits of installing an ETS disinfection system, while avoiding the spread of infection and disease.

SHELLFISH PRODUCTION | Shrimp/prawn, crab and lobster production utilize large volumes of water in holding tanks, rinse water and process water. UV disinfection is critical to these production applications to avoid contamination without the need of harsh chemical disinfectants.

AQUARIUMS & ZOOS | Traditional Ozone systems are being replaced with next generation UV technology systems due to the vast benefits UV technology offers. Additionally UV can be used in any application from aquariums and wash water to large open sea lion pools and water features.

AQUATIC LABORATORIES | Many aquatic laboratories rely on UV treatment to ensure their process water remains pathogen free. Additionally UV disinfection is used to ensure effluent discharges are environmentally safe and do not become a source of contamination.

MAKEUP WATER | During emptying and venting of sterile holding tanks, airborne bacteria can enter the vessel. UV units designed to fit into piping are ideal in reducing this potential means of infection, reducing the risk of costly production down time.

BLOOD WATER & DISCHARGES | Fish farms are often located in close proximity. Effluent discharges from one farm poses a significant threat of contamination to another. ETS UV systems are proven to provide an effective barrier against harmful micro-organisms, while ETS' leading wiper design allows for disinfection of waste water.
